European Microfinance Award 2025: A Call to Action
The launch of the European Microfinance Award (EMA) 2025, themed "Building Resilience through Inclusive Insurance," is a significant step toward addressing these gaps. Organizations from across the globe are invited to apply for this award, which seeks to highlight innovative approaches to providing insurance to underserved communities. The award emphasizes the transformative potential of inclusive insurance for low-income households, offering monetary rewards while simultaneously raising awareness about effective risk management tools that can support resilience. The winner stands to earn €100,000, with two runners-up receiving €10,000 each, an impactful incentive for participants eager to make a difference.

Building Bridges Through Innovation
Innovative approaches in product design and delivery are paramount in making insurance appealing to low-income families. By integrating insurance with everyday services—like microfinance or agricultural support—organizations can create a more approachable experience while enhancing trust. Ultimately, promoting these solutions can lead to sustainable management of risk and economic resilience within communities.
